Termination of Options. ---------------------- (a) Unless otherwise provided for in Section 8 of this Agreement and Section 5 of the Plan, all unvested Options shall expire upon any termination of Optionee's employment or contractual relationship with the Company, whether voluntary or involuntary, or upon the death or Disability of Optionee. (b) Unless otherwise provided for in Section 8 of this Agreement and Section 5 of the Plan, all vested Options shall expire at the earliest of the following: (1) ten (10) years from the date of the Notice; provided, however, that the expiration date of any Incentive Stock Option granted to a greater-than-10% shareholder shall not be later than five (5) years from the date of Grant; (2) three (3) months after voluntary or involuntary termination of Optionee's employment or contractual relationship with the Company other than termination as described in Paragraphs (3) or (4) below; (3) upon termination of Optionee's employment or contractual relationship with the Company for cause (as determined in the sole discretion of the Plan Administrator); or (4) one (1) year after the termination of Optionee's employment or contractual relationship with the Company on account of Optionee's death or Disability. 4. Type of Option; Tax Consequences. Unless otherwise provided for in -------------------------------- the Notice, Options granted in accordance with the Plan shall be Non-Qualified Stock Options ("NSO"). If the Notice provides that Options granted to Optionee are Incentive Stock Options ("ISO"), such Options are intended to qualify as Incentive Stock Options under Section 422 of the Code. Set forth below is a brief summary as of the date of this Agreement of some of the federal tax consequences of exercise of this Option and disposition of the Option Shares. THIS SUMMARY IS NECESSARILY INCOMPLETE, AND THE TAX LAWS AND REGULATIONS ARE SUBJECT TO CHANGE. THE OPTIONEE SHOULD CONSULT A TAX ADVISER BEFORE EXERCISING THIS OPTION OR DISPOSING OF THE OPTION SHARES. (a) Exercise of NSO. There may be a regular federal income tax liability, at ordinary income tax rates, upon the exercise of an NSO. If Optionee is an Employee or a former Employee, the Company will be required to withhold from Optionee's compensation or collect from Optionee and pay to the applicable taxing authorities an amount in cash equal to a percentage of this compensation income at the time of exercise, and may refuse to honor the exercise and refuse to deliver Shares if such withholding amounts are not delivered at the time of exercise. (b) Exercise of ISO. If this Option qualifies as an ISO, there will be no regular federal income tax liability upon the exercise of the Option, although the Optionee may be subject to the alternative minimum tax in the year of exercise. (c) Disposition of Shares. The disposition of Option Shares is generally a taxable event. The tax treatment will depend on whether the Option is an ISO or an NSO, and on the length of time for which Optionee has held the Option Shares. 7. Notice of Disqualifying Disposition of ISO Shares.
